Saturday morning, we arrived at the Atlanta airport to a zoo... literally. There were at least 150 people waiting to leave Atlanta through the International gates. And with a similar thunderstorm on the horizon as had canceled flights on Friday looming, everyone was looking to get out quickly.

We got rechecked in, through security and to our gate. We had vouchers left over from the previous day, which we used at the airport for breakfast, coffee (one last Starbucks for me before leaving) and other assorted items.

Only to find our flight delayed.

We ended up being delayed for about 2 hours. There was a problem with the plane that we were supposed to take. So they off-loaded all of our luggage, in the pouring rain, and replaced our plane with another. So we arrived in Santiago 2 hours later than we expected.

One nice thing about the flight to Santiago was that it wasn't crowded at all. So there was plenty of room to spread out.

After arriving in Santiago, getting through immigration, customs, and other assorted lines, we discovered that my luggage hadn't arrived with the rest of the groups. (BUMMER!!!) All that I had in my backpack was a pair of shorts, a pair of underwear and another T-shirt.

More on that later...

After filling out the necessary form, we piled in the bus to head to Casa de Gabriel. On the way to the Casa, John informed us that we would be doing the VBS that we had been planning to do immediately after getting off the bus. This was a little stressful to say the least, considering that we had not done any assigning of roles or much specific preparation.

We managed to pull off the VBS. It didn't go as well as we would have hoped, but it worked. Following the VBS, we got settled, ate dinner and then headed out for some ice cream.
